Output 68f8126106c3c55c88d949d9f3702f3948f99abf469d4a3facec39b2bbf18a44:4

value
33314415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 794caf74b52c9e9fa9f661d38b2f72f3823d2fbf OP_EQUAL
address
3CkPYwxuMqWsoShH6RWRsJTimT9vbSsae7
transaction
68f8126106c3c55c88d949d9f3702f3948f99abf469d4a3facec39b2bbf18a44
spent
true